新手求救大佬

来源:2-1 有名有姓的C

慕仰8146024

2017-11-12 11:49

5a07c48b000167ec07440992.jpg
求解!

写回答 关注

2回答

  • 慕侠8100721
    2017-11-12 16:23:57
    已采纳

    #include <stdio.h>

    int main()

    {

           int x=0,y=0;

            int n;

            char a;

            printf("请输入要参与运算的字母数,必须2-1000个\n");

            scanf("%d",&x);

             for(int m=0;m<x;m++)

                {

                    scanf("%c   ",&a);

                    if(65<=a<=90)

                     n=(int) a-64;

                    else if(97<=a<=122)

                        n=(int) a-96;

                    y=y+n;

                }

              printf("\n%d",y);

    return 0;

    }  


    慕仰8146...

    谢谢了!

    2017-11-13 22:40:31

    共 7 条回复 >

  • 慕侠8100721
    2017-11-12 17:02:54

    #include <stdio.h>

    int main()

    {

    int x=0,y=0;

    int n;

    char a;

    printf("请输入要参与运算的字母数,必须2-1000个\n");

    scanf("%d",&x);

    for(int m=0;m<x;m++)

    {

    getchar();

    scanf("%c",&a); 

    n= (int) a;

    if(65<=n && n<=90)

    n=n-64;

    else if(97<=n && n<=122)

    n=n-96;

    y=y+n;

    }

      printf("\n%d",y);

    return 0;


C语言入门

C语言入门视频教程,带你进入编程世界的必修课-C语言

926210 学习 · 20797 问题

查看课程

相似问题